Ambient temperature display:
A.TEMP
25
This display shows the ambient tem-
perature from –9 °C to 50 °C in 1 °C in-
crements. The temperature displayed
may vary from the ambient tempera-
ture.
TIP
–9 °C will be displayed even if the
ambient temperature falls below
–9 °C.
50 °C will be displayed even if the
ambient temperature climbs above
50 °C.
INSTRUMENT AND CONTROL FUNCTIONS
The accuracy of the temperature
reading may be affected when
riding slowly [approximately under
20 km/h (12.5 mi/h)] or when
stopped at traffic signals, railroad
crossings, etc.
Coolant temperature display:
C.TEMP
˚C
The coolant temperature display indi-
cates the temperature of the coolant.
The coolant temperature varies with
changes in the weather and engine
load.
If the message "Hi" flashes, stop the ve-
hicle, then stop the engine, and let the
engine cool. (See page 6-37.)
˚C
Lo
TIP
The selected information display can-
not be switched while the message "Hi"
is flashing.
NOTICE
Do not continue to operate the en-
gine if it is overheating.
